#415a01 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#415a01 is composed of 25.5% red, 35.3%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 98.9% yellow and 64.7% black. It has a hue angle of 76.9 degrees, a saturation of 97.8% and a lightness of 17.8%. #415a01 color hex could be obtained by blending #82b402 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

Shades and Tints of #415a01
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090c00 is the darkest color, while #fdfff8 is the lightest one.
